What is cdad10ba.sys
The cdad10ba.sys is the file identified with the CD Rom Security driver for Microsoft Windows NT. As a device driver, it still maintains the primary function of providing the link between the computer/network system and the device to be connected. However, Microsoft Windows NT (New Technology) was developed for advanced users and it aims to provide special needs for added security and customization. These features are above the standard for the average Windows, thus the CD drive is enhanced by Macrovision Europe (the program’s manufacturer). Macrovision produced CD drivers that managed to restrict copying programs and data from a CD, specifically game programs. The Security is standard issue for the Microsoft NT, as security concerns are a priority for most of its clients. The CD Rom Security Driver also conforms to the Windows NT’s high standard of hardware to software architecture.
How can I stop cdad10ba.sys and should I?
Most non-system processes that are running can be stopped because they are not involved in running your operating system. cdad10ba.sys. is used by Macrovision Europe CD Rom SECURITY driver for Microsoft Windows NT, If you shut down cdad10ba.sys, it will likely start again at a later time either after you restart your computer or after an application start. To stop cdad10ba.sys, permanently you need to uninstall the application that runs this process which in this case is Macrovision Europe CD Rom SECURITY driver for Microsoft Windows NT, from your system.

What is a process and how do they affect my computer?
A process usually a part of an installed application such as Macrovision Europe CD Rom SECURITY driver for Microsoft Windows NT, or your operating system that is responsible for running in functions of that application. Some application require that they have processes running all the time so they can do things such as check for updates or notify you when you get an instant message. Some poorly written applications have many processes that run that may not be required and take up valuable processing power within your computer.
